遇到SATerminalProcessing数据库错误时,可以尝试以下几种方法来快速解决问题:
### 1. 检查数据库连接字符串
确保你的数据库连接字符串是正确的。一个错误的连接字符串可能导致无法连接到数据库,从而引发SATerminalProcessing错误。
```csharp
string connectionString = "Server=myServerAddress;Database=myDataBase;User Id=myUsername;Password=myPassword;";
```
### 2. 更新数据库驱动程序
有时候,数据库驱动程序版本不兼容也会导致这种错误。尝试更新到最新版本的数据库驱动程序。
### 3. 检查数据库权限
确保你的数据库用户有足够的权限访问和操作数据库。如果权限不足,可能会导致SATerminalProcessing错误。
### 4. 检查SQL查询
如果你在执行SQL查询时遇到这个错误,检查你的SQL查询语句是否有语法错误或逻辑错误。
```sql
SELECT * FROM myTable WHERE id = 1;
```
### 5. 捕获异常并记录日志
在你的代码中添加异常捕获和日志记录,以便更好地了解错误的具体原因。
```csharp
try
{
// Your database operations here
}
catch (Exception ex)
{
Console.WriteLine("An error occurred: " + ex.Message);
// Log the exception details for further analysis
}
```
### 6. 检查数据库服务器状态
确保你的数据库服务器正在运行并且没有出现任何问题。你可以通过数据库管理工具(如SQL Server Management Studio)来检查服务器状态。
### 7. 重启应用程序和数据库服务
有时候,简单的重启应用程序和数据库服务可以解决一些临时性的问题。
### 8. 联系技术支持
如果以上方法都无法解决问题,建议联系数据库供应商的技术支持团队,他们通常能够提供更详细的帮助和解决方案。
希望这些方法能够帮助你快速解决SATerminalProcessing数据库错误。